MUHAMMAD KAMRAN KHAN NIAZI versus WAPDA


Electricity Act 1910 Section 26 (6) Civil Code of Conduct (v. 1908), Section 9 Constitution of Pakistan (1973), Article 199 Constitution Petition on the validity of the electricity bill, the applicant asked him to amend the electricity bill question and Had demanded legal status. Those who were in fact realistic could not be investigated without such factual matter being investigated and investigated, which could not normally be done under the constitutional jurisdiction of the High Court. Under the Act, 1910, or the civil court, the electric inspector was the proper alternative treatment. Submit representation under Section 9 of the CPC or to the Executive Engineer
